ในโครงการคุณต้องตรวจสอบว่าสตริงอินพุตว่างเปล่ารวมถึงช่องว่าง คุณไม่ต้องการใช้ความสม่ำเสมอดังนั้นคุณจึงนึกถึงฟังก์ชั่นดัชนีของ JS เมธอดดัชนี () สามารถส่งคืนตำแหน่งที่ค่าสตริงที่ระบุจะปรากฏขึ้นเป็นครั้งแรกในสตริง หากค่าสตริงที่จะเรียกคืนจะไม่ปรากฏขึ้นเมธอดจะกลับมา -1
ไวยากรณ์: StringObject.indexof (SearchValue, FromIndex), SearchValue ที่ต้องการ, FromDex: พารามิเตอร์เสริม, ตำแหน่งที่การค้นหาเริ่มต้นในสตริง ค่าทางกฎหมายของมันคือ 0 ถึง StringObject.length - 1. หากละเว้นพารามิเตอร์นี้การค้นหาจะเริ่มต้นจากอักขระแรกของสตริง
การสาธิต: ฟังก์ชั่น checkValue () {var enumValue = document.getElementById ('txtenumValue') ค่า; if (enumValue.indexof ("")> = 0) {แจ้งเตือน ("เนื้อหาไม่สามารถมีช่องว่าง!"); กลับเท็จ; } if (enumValue == "") {แจ้งเตือน ("โปรดป้อนเนื้อหา!"); กลับเท็จ; -รหัสการใช้งาน JS ข้างต้นที่ไม่จำเป็นต้องมีการตรวจสอบเป็นประจำว่าสตริงที่ป้อนนั้นว่างเปล่า (รวมถึงช่องว่าง) เป็นเนื้อหาทั้งหมดที่ฉันได้แชร์กับคุณหรือไม่ ฉันหวังว่ามันจะให้ข้อมูลอ้างอิงและฉันหวังว่าคุณจะสนับสนุน wulin.com มากขึ้น